DIY vs. Hiring Professionals: Finding the Right Balance
DIY home projects can be a rewarding way to personalize your space while saving money. However, it’s crucial to understand which projects you can handle yourself and which are best left to professionals. In this guide, I will explore the benefits of DIY and when it’s wise to bring in the experts.
The Benefits of DIY: Creativity and Cost Savings
One of the biggest draws of DIY projects is the opportunity to save money and unleash your creativity. From building furniture to DIY holiday decorations, taking on projects yourself enables you to add a personal touch to your home. DIY is particularly effective for smaller tasks like painting, landscaping, and organizing your garage.
The Downsides of DIY: Hidden Costs and Complexity
While DIY can be enjoyable and fulfilling, it’s not always the best option. Larger projects can quickly become overwhelming, especially when unexpected challenges arise. For example, you might need specialized tools or permits, and what seemed like a simple task could take much longer than anticipated.
DIY mistakes can also be costly. For projects like electrical work, plumbing, or major renovations, errors could lead to higher repair costs than if you had hired a professional from the start. When to Hire a Provider: Complex or Specialized Projects
Certain projects require a higher level of expertise and are better left to professionals. Here are a few scenarios where it makes sense to hire a pro:
- Electrical and Plumbing Work: Safety is a major concern here. A licensed professional can ensure the job is done correctly and up to code.
- Structural or Foundation Repairs: For projects that involve altering your home’s structure, it’s essential to hire experienced general contractors who can manage these types of tasks.
- Insulation Installation: While DIY might be fine for small gaps, larger insulation needs require professional expertise. Proper insulation protects your home from energy loss and keeps your residence comfortable throughout the year.
For extensive insulation projects, professionals know how to apply the right techniques to maximize efficiency and avoid gaps.
